
A | Legendary actor Dharmendra, also known as Bollywood's He-Man, passed away today, leaving a void in the industry. Ever since the news broke, not just his fans, but the industry folks have been sharing tributes on social media and recalling their association with him. A couple of years back, Filmfare had spoken exclusively to Rajveer Deol, Dharmendra's grandson and Sunny Deol's son about his grandfather. He spoke to us about the things he learnt from the veteran actor and his bond with him.
Talking about his bonding with Dharmendra, Rajveer said, "He used to pamper me, giving me literally anything I asked him. I was close to him growing up. And so was my brother. I’ve learnt from him that the main thing is the craft of acting; that stardom is something I should not really pay attention to. And if it comes, it comes. It’s not something you chase."
Sunny Deol’s younger son Rajveer Deol made his debut in Dono, directed by Sooraj Barjatya’s son Avnish and co-starring Poonam Dhillon’s daughter Paloma. Talking about how Dharmendra was always a fan favourite, he continued, "And I love that. It feels good just to see him connect with fans. He puts himself out there completely and he responds to people he interacts with."
Asked whether he grew up watching his grandfather’s films, Rajveer answered, "I’ve watched a lot of movies starring my father, grandfather, and even my uncle, Bobby Deol. But those weren’t the only movies I’ve watched. I’ve seen a lot of world cinema and regional cinema as well."
Dharmendra made his debut in 1960 and quickly became a superstar. He was known for his versatility, mastering roles from the romantic hero to the tough action star. His career boasts over 300 films, many of which are considered classics today. Some of his most memorable performances include the iconic role of Veeru in the cult classic Sholay, as well as memorable performances in Phool Aur Patthar, Seeta Aur Geeta, Chupke Chupke, Dharam Veer, and Pratigya. Datong Customs has introduced full-cycle services and smarter supervision across the agricultural supply chain. Working with local agricultural and market regulatory authorities, it carried out joint inspections, training, guidance and problem-solving services, visiting more than 20 enterprises during the first half of the year. The Datong Municipal Commerce Bureau has also adopted a tailored "one enterprise, one policy" approach. In Tianzhen County, a cross-border e-commerce and miscellaneous grains industrial park has been established, bringing together nine agricultural e-commerce companies and creating a digital channel for local agricultural products to reach overseas markets. Customs authorities have also stepped up support for local exporters. In Hunyuan County, officials have worked with enterprises to facilitate exports, while a company in Lingqiu County received one-on-one guidance on registration procedures for exporting chili sauce to Mongolia. Datong Customs has also helped leading companies, including Tianzhen Bocheng Vegetable Co., Ltd., obtain AEO (Authorized Economic Operator) certification. Measures such as online certificate issuance and streamlined customs clearance procedures have further improved efficiency. Processed food exports have emerged as a key driver of growth. In the first half of the year, Datong's tomato paste exports surged 476.2% year on year, while buckwheat flour exports rose 47%. Dehydrated vegetables from Tianzhen County have also been showcased at several international exhibitions, helping local companies secure orders worth millions of dollars. Datong has continued to expand the overseas reach of its agricultural products. Locally produced tomato paste has entered markets including Russia, Mali, Moldova and Gambia, while the city exported tomato sauce to the Republic of Korea for the first time. Local companies have also participated in major international food exhibitions, including SIAL Paris and the Global Traditional Food and Nutrition Products Expo, securing multiple cooperation agreements. Meanwhile, international recognition of "Datong Hao Liang" (Datong Good Grains), the city's regional agricultural brand, has continued to grow. (By Tang Yuxian)
